Advertisement

易语言-抢酷狗繁星红包的sign算法

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程详细介绍如何使用易语言编写用于获取酷狗繁星平台红包的sign算法,帮助开发者理解并实现签名机制。 酷狗繁星抢红包sign源码的描述可以简化为:提供关于如何获取或使用酷狗繁星平台中的抢红包功能所需的相关代码资源的信息。如果需要具体的技术细节或者实现方法,通常会包括一些编程技术方面的讨论或是特定函数和参数的解释说明。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• -sign
    优质
    本教程详细介绍如何使用易语言编写用于获取酷狗繁星平台红包的sign算法,帮助开发者理解并实现签名机制。 酷狗繁星抢红包sign源码的描述可以简化为:提供关于如何获取或使用酷狗繁星平台中的抢红包功能所需的相关代码资源的信息。如果需要具体的技术细节或者实现方法,通常会包括一些编程技术方面的讨论或是特定函数和参数的解释说明。
  • -详解
    优质
    本教程深入解析了利用易语言进行微信抢红包概率分析及代码实现的方法,适合编程爱好者和技术开发者学习参考。 抢红包算法采用二倍均值法可以确保每次随机金额的平均值相等,避免了因先后顺序导致的不公平现象。 但是这种方法也有一个缺点: 除了最后一次外,任何一次领取到的金额都会小于人均金额的两倍,并不是完全随机分配。 还有一种方法叫线段切割法:具体思路是如果有N个人一起抢红包,则需要生成N-1个分割点。进行N-1次随机运算时,每次操作都在(0,总金额)区间内完成。当有人领取红包时,按照顺序依次领取即可。 需要注意的是要处理可能出现的重复切割点问题。
  • -关于小sign探讨
    优质
    本篇笔记深入浅出地探讨了小红书中常用的签名算法(sign算法),旨在帮助开发者们更好地理解并运用这一技术细节。适合有一定编程基础、特别是对易语言感兴趣的朋友们阅读和学习。 易语言是一种专为中国人设计的编程语言,它以简明的中文语法降低了编程门槛,使更多非专业的程序员能够快速上手。在讨论如何用易语言实现小红书平台签名算法时,我们主要关注的是网络通信中至关重要的部分——即验证数据完整性和发送者身份的过程。 作为社交电商平台的小红书中,API接口调用通常需要进行签名过程以确保请求的安全性。签名校验一般包括对请求参数的排序、哈希计算以及添加密钥等步骤来生成唯一签名值,服务器端会通过同样的算法验证这个签名值是否一致以确认请求的有效性。 在易语言中实现小红书的签名算法时,我们需要理解以下几个关键概念和技术: 1. **哈希函数**:这是整个过程的核心部分。常见的哈希函数包括MD5或SHA系列等,它们可以将任意长度的信息转化为固定长度的数据,并且任何微小的变化都会导致不同的输出结果。 2. **参数排序**:所有请求参数需按照键名的字典顺序排列以生成签名值,因为不同顺序会产生不同的哈希结果。 3. **字符串拼接**:按序排好的参数与预设密钥(通常是API密钥)相连接形成原始字符串供后续处理使用。 4. **哈希计算**:选定合适的哈希函数对上述形成的原始字符串进行运算得出最终的签名值。 5. **Base64编码**:为了便于在网络上传输,通常会将生成的哈希结果通过Base64转换成可打印字符形式。 在实际编程中,根据小红书API的具体要求编写签名算法时还可能需要考虑URL编码、时间戳和随机数等额外因素以增加安全性。同时,在调试阶段确保自定义签名函数与服务器端验证逻辑完全匹配是成功调用API的关键步骤之一。 掌握这些原理和技术细节,并结合易语言提供的工具类库,我们能够开发出符合标准的易语言小红书平台签名算法代码,从而实现安全的数据交互操作。这一过程不仅涉及到编程技术的应用,还涵盖了网络安全知识的学习与实践,在提升开发者技能方面具有重要意义。
  • 用C实现
    优质
    本段介绍了一种基于C语言编写的高效抢红包算法,详细描述了其实现机制和优化策略,旨在提供公平且快速的用户体验。 本段落实例展示了如何用C语言实现抢红包的功能,供参考。 1、算法背景: 微信中有两种类型的红包:普通红包和个人运气随机的拼手气红包。在普通红包中,每个人领取到的钱是相同的(即总金额被平分);而在拼手气红包里,则每个人的所得会有所不同(差距可能非常大)。当前抢红包的功能仅支持输入两项参数——总额和人数。 2、算法要求: 现在需要设计一个改进的版本,允许设定总的金额(total)、参与的人数(num),以及每个人能够领取到的最低(min)和最高(max)额度。这样可以确保每个参与者拿到的钱既不会过少也不会过多。
  • 永辉生活sign解析
    优质
    本文档深入分析了永辉生活易语言中使用的sign算法,旨在帮助开发者理解其工作原理并应用于实际开发场景。 永辉生活sign算法源码
  • A源代码-
    优质
    本资源提供基于易语言编写的A*(A-Star)寻路算法源代码,适用于游戏开发、迷宫求解等领域。包含详细注释与示例,帮助开发者快速上手实现智能路径规划功能。 易语言是一种专为中国用户设计的编程语言,它采用简体中文作为语法基础,降低了学习门槛,并鼓励更多人参与程序开发。 本压缩包内的“易语言A星算法源码”是针对该语言的一个高级教程示例代码,旨在帮助开发者理解和应用A*(A Star)寻路算法。此算法在图形搜索中非常有效,在游戏开发和地图导航等领域有广泛应用。其主要目标是在有向图或网格环境中寻找从起点到终点的最短路径。通过结合Dijkstra算法与贪婪最佳优先搜索的优点,并引入启发式函数来预估节点间距离,A*算法能够显著缩小搜索范围并提高效率。 在易语言中实现这一算法时,请关注以下核心概念: 1. **节点(Node)**:代表路径上的每个位置,包含坐标、成本值g和估算价值f。 2. **开放列表(Open List)**:存储待处理的节点,并按f值排序以优先考虑最小者。 3. **关闭列表(Closed List)**:存放已处理过的节点,避免重复搜索。 4. **启发式函数(Heuristic Function)**:通常使用曼哈顿距离或欧几里得距离来估算从当前点到目标点的距离。 5. **代价函数(G Function)**:表示从起点到达某一特定位置的实际成本。 6. **f值(F Function)**:g值与启发式估计的总和,用于评估节点的重要性。 实现A*算法时需完成以下步骤: - 初始化阶段:设定起始点及终点,并清除开放列表与关闭列表的内容; - 主循环操作:只要开放表不为空,则选取具有最小f值得到当前处理节点并将其加入关闭列表;同时更新其邻居的g值和f值。 - 节点扩展过程:对于每个相邻节点,计算新的g值及f值。如果该邻近已经在关闭清单中或新成本更高则跳过它;否则将此节点添加至开放表内等待处理; - 结束条件判断:当发现目标位置或者开放列表为空时算法终止运行。若找到终点,则可以追溯路径生成结果;反之,表明无可行路线。 压缩包中的“A星.e”文件大概率是使用易语言编写的A*算法源代码,通过阅读与分析这份文件能够帮助你掌握在该环境下实现此算法的方法。熟练运用这一技术不仅有助于提升编程技能,也能使你在游戏开发或其他需要路径规划的项目中更具竞争力。 实践中可能还需要考虑如何优化性能问题,比如采用优先队列、改进数据结构设计以及选择合适的启发式函数等策略来进一步提高效率和效果。
  • 基于JAVA模拟
    优质
    本项目采用Java语言开发,旨在模拟微信等社交软件中的抢红包功能。通过设计合理的随机分配机制来实现公平、有趣的游戏体验,适合编程爱好者和技术学习者研究。 本段落主要介绍了使用JAVA实现简单抢红包算法(模拟真实场景)的实例代码,具有很好的参考价值,有需要的朋友可以参考一下。
  • A寻路
    优质
    本文章详细介绍了如何在易语言编程环境中实现A*(A-Star)寻路算法,并探讨了其在游戏开发等领域的应用。 A星(A*)寻路算法是计算机图形学与游戏开发领域广泛使用的一种路径搜索方法,它结合了Dijkstra最短路径算法的准确性以及启发式函数预测能力来寻找图或网格中从起点到终点的最优路径。易语言是一种由中国自主研发、适合初学者和专业开发者使用的编程工具。 在易语言环境中实现A星寻路功能能够为游戏开发及其他需要智能导航的应用提供高效解决方案。该算法通过评估每个节点的实际代价(G值)与估计到达目标的成本(H值),计算F值(即F = G + H)。优先处理具有最小F值的节点,直至找到终点或无法继续优化路径为止。 实现A星寻路的关键步骤包括: 1. 数据结构:通常使用二叉堆等数据结构来维护需要检查的节点列表,并根据它们的F值排序。还需建立邻接表或者矩阵以表示地图中的连接关系。 2. 启发式函数选择与调整:启发式函数用于评估某点到目标的大致距离,例如曼哈顿、欧几里得或切比雪夫等方法适用于不同场景下的路径估算。 3. 节点信息管理:每个节点需记录其G值和F值,并存储指向父节点的指针以重建最短路线。 4. 搜索机制:从初始位置开始,每次选择优先队列中具有最小F值得到当前处理单元。更新邻近未访问过结点的状态并将其加入待检查列表直至达到目标或搜索完毕为止。 5. 路径重构:当找到终点后,依据指针信息逆向追踪回溯路径。 在易语言环境中可能存在一个名为`Astart.dll`的动态链接库文件用于封装和调用核心算法逻辑。此外还有诸如“A星测试.e”、“寻路例程.e”的示例程序帮助开发者理解如何利用这些资源来实现特定功能需求。 游戏开发中,应用此技术可以支持角色自动导航、敌方单位的行为决策以及NPC的路径规划等功能。易语言版本的A*算法简化了复杂路线计算过程的学习难度,并允许通过修改启发式函数和改进数据结构进一步优化性能表现及适应更多场景变化。
  • 版淘宝商品采集Post请求+Sign
    优质
    本项目提供了一套使用易语言实现的淘宝商品信息自动采集工具,采用POST请求方式,并集成了Sign安全校验算法,保障数据抓取的安全性和准确性。 淘宝店铺商品采集源码附带Sign算法,提供Php、Js、易语言三个版本。该算法能够检测滑块并实现单页多页数据的采集与保存登录状态功能,并支持导出信息等手机端接口。由于发现接口存在限制,因此决定开源此项目。